Questions people ask

What is the median household income in Pennsylvania?

About $80,000 for 2024, in the Census CPS ASEC.

What income is the top 10% in Pennsylvania?

About $241,064. The top 1% estimate ($707,750) carries meaningful sampling error at state level.
